Be it in any stack starting from net developers to information engineers and cloud computing consultants. Similarly, low code platforms Query Surge, Power BI, and Docker assist companies avoid plenty of work and provide simple interfaces to construct new apps at a low investment of cash, time, and specific skills. A decade ago, creating any type of digital resolution took large and dedicated teams of software engineers and architects https://forexarticles.net/how-to-choose-on-the-best-ai-foundation-model/.
- The latest software technologies not solely drive innovation but in addition maintain the potential to transform industries.
- This revolutionary expertise is ready to redefine how we communicate and work together with the digital world.
- React makes building quick and high-performance native or cross-platform purposes straightforward.
- Let’s delve into the top software growth developments within the upcoming 12 months, from artificial intelligence, and extra sophisticated cybersecurity.
High 7 Trending Software Growth Technologies For 2024
The instruments utilized in CI/CD provide a broad range of advantages from code repositories to test suites which makes improvement more streamlined and secure. This development development is sure to take hold as its efficiencies are plain, leading to improved product growth timelines but additionally increased buyer satisfaction. Indeed, the worldwide transition to remote work and the want to facilitate it has provoked a powerful uptake of cloud computing. And with distant work still at the high of the listing among startups, cloud computing software engineers are extra in demand than ever. With 15+ years of software program development expertise, we possess not solely in depth digital capabilities but in addition the agility and reliability required to tackle any project. Process automation, which coordinates the method teams deploy to create software program, is progressively key for its functionality to deliver finest practices.
The Longer Term Is Now: 10 Applied Sciences Changing The Way We Develop Software Program
Virtual reality in software program growth creates a simulated 3d setting in which customers immerse themselves and interact with the digital world. The OpenAI Chat GPT and generative AI apps like Elevenlabs are trending software, making the software growth course of quicker, simpler, and extra efficient. The integration of Artificial Intelligence (AI) into software development processes is about to speed up, streamlining duties corresponding to code era, debugging, and testing. Expect AI to become an indispensable ally for developers, enhancing productiveness and aiding in decision-making throughout the development lifecycle. According to the survey held by Stack Overflow, it’s the most-wanted language and beloved language among builders.
There are more than seven hundred languages for programming but corporations typically require assistance in deciding on the appropriate language for his or her application or internet improvement project. Using Ethical AI will assist to fill the trust hole between customers and technology as cyber security measures are strengthened in order that confidence in automated methods can proceed. The integration of AI growth providers opens up opportunities for brands of all sizes and shapes, together with tech giants in addition to small digital marketplaces. Kotlin was created in 2011 as a practical answer to Java lacking some desired options and being compatible with current Java code bases.
According to Forbes, 96% of shoppers cited experience as the key to instilling brand loyalty. As cyber threats grow, sturdy safety measures and advancements in Cybersecurity are becoming important. Meanwhile, Blockchain is rising as a key participant in e-commerce and different sectors, ensuring secure transactions. Blockchain can be being adopted in supply chain management, finance, and other industries as a outcome of it provides a decentralized and secure method for conducting transactions.
DevSecOps prioritizes early detection of potential dangers and fixing these vulnerabilities earlier than they become more important issues. Lambda takes care of duties such as user authentication, encoding movies, and backend processes. This allows Netflix to scale its resources based on demand while not having to manage servers while offering a smooth user expertise and slicing prices. Like blockchain expertise, progressive Web Apps (PWAs) are additionally not new — they’ve been round since their introduction in 2015.
Middleware code will remain a trending technology within the coming years, as IaaS remains to be an essential element in a serverless architecture. Progressive Web Apps mix the most effective of net sites and cellular apps, providing a clean person experience with out the necessity for downloading. In a 2021 GitLab survey, 70% of safety professionals stated their teams had moved safety earlier within the growth course of. The mixture of improvement, security, and operations (DevSecOps) represents a new software program development strategy that integrates security all through the whole IT lifecycle. However, the know-how has implications for the software program improvement business as properly. Besides aiding in software development, AI instruments are additionally being carried out to assist enhance processes in a number of completely different industries.
This data is distributed to the maintenance staff who can repair the problem before it can cause downtime. Rather than constructing one great service, builders will break the functionality into manageable sections. The software will include microservices, where each one performs a single function but does it impeccably. Founded in 2011, we’ve been offering full-cycle mobile and internet growth services to clients from various industries. However, in case you are seeking to outsource your software project then undergo our guide on the method to outsource app growth.
Therefore, PWAs are undoubtedly one of many tendencies in software improvement to watch and benefit from. The introduction of COVID-19 intensified the importance of digital and remote healthcare. Trained on a big dataset of human conversations, this pure language processing mannequin is already extensively used to streamline varied enterprise processes from creating social media content to lead technology.
AI and ML will mainly be used for automation, self-learning capabilities, data security and privacy, in addition to customized cloud experiences. Companies can thus reap massive alternatives in cloud computing with the assistance of AI and ML applied sciences. The projected progress in investments between now and 2026 proves just how integral AI and ML have turn into in practical functions in cloud computing.
According to altering adjustments in the digital landscape and business wants, the specific demand could differ. 300+ successful tasks have been completed by us throughout our almost ten-year historical past as a prime provider of software improvement companies. Technologies in software improvement change more quickly than in any other business. The reason is the large-scale adoption of software technologies in every industry from healthcare to automation and accounting.
For startup founders, low-code development is perfect to shortly idealize business ideas and check them out with the users. Requirement modifications can be shortly applied with low-code instruments in a comparatively cheap manner. By adopting steady delivery, it’s possible to implement suggestions and determine issues more efficiently and at a decrease price. Therefore, it’s necessary for startups to have interaction improvement teams capable of working in shorter sprint cycles. The first software growth trend that everyone talks about is Artificial Intelligence. The way software program development is going on keeps changing, especially because of the current global disaster.
Traditional applications, like smart properties and assistants, will still be relevant, but the focus will shift to more world use instances. For developers, incorporating AI of their options additionally becomes a must-have rather than a most popular follow. Google acknowledged this tendency and developed TensorFlow — a library for neural community development. Combined with Theano, one of the most prominent AI frameworks, it provides builders with a quick environment for building and testing neural networks. However, enterprises understood that to develop an intuitive and complicated answer, neglecting the requirements of native development isn’t at all times one of the best guess.